๐Œ๐ฒ ๐“๐ก๐จ๐ฎ๐ ๐ก๐ญ๐ฌ ๐Ÿ’ญ

This was fun, but wowโ€”it moved fast. Like, zero-to-obsessed in record time. I love a good slow burn, some build-up and tension, but Caleb (the straight roommate) basically decided within days that he was totally fine being obsessed with Whit, and the rest was history! While their dynamic was cute, I wanted more push and pull and more anticipation before they fell into their relationship.

Caleb was quick to fall. He was super clingy in an adorable way, but it just didn't feel realistic to me. He was so laid-back about everything, which is great, but it also made me question his character a lot. As the story went on, you do learn more about him, and I can see why he's so clingyโ€”he clearly craves the comfort Whit gives him. Whit was a good character, but he was so quiet and mysterious that I didnโ€™t feel like we really got to see much of his personality. His horrible upbringing explains why heโ€™s so controlling and stuck in his ways, but I wanted to see a bit more fun from him.

These two were complete oppositesโ€”Whit was unexpectedly possessive, and Caleb was just all-in, no hesitation, not at all shy, and ready to take on the world. Their dynamic was fun, even if the pacing was a little wild. I definitely felt for Caleb at the endโ€”well, both of them reallyโ€”but Caleb had the rug pulled from beneath him, and I really felt for him. They had some really cute and fun moments, too, though! 

This was my first Cora Rose book, and while I enjoyed it, the writing style was a little exaggerated at times. I also listened to the audiobook, which might have made it feel even more over the top. Maybe reading it instead would have changed my view slightly, though Iโ€™m not sure by much. It was entertaining and not a bad read at all. I liked it but didnโ€™t love it. Probably not one Iโ€™d reach for again.
